Mountain bike trails around Ambiegna are situated in West Corsica, a region characterized by its diverse natural landscapes. The village is nestled at 367 meters altitude, surrounded by forests, offering immediate access to natural environments. This area features varied terrain, from mountainous backdrops to proximity to the coast, providing a range of experiences for mountain bikers. The region's geology includes dramatic red granite cliffs and river valleys, contributing to the varied trail conditions.

There are over 25 mountain bike trails around Ambiegna, offering a diverse range of experiences. These include 4 easy routes, 12 moderate routes, and 9 difficult routes, catering to various skill levels.
Mountain biking around Ambiegna features varied terrain, from forested hills and rugged, mountainous landscapes to areas with coastal proximity. The region is known for its dramatic red granite cliffs and river valleys, providing diverse trail conditions and scenic backdrops.
Yes, Ambiegna offers 4 easy mountain bike routes. While specific family-friendly routes are not detailed, the presence of easy trails suggests options for less experienced riders. The region's diverse landscape means you can find paths that are less technically demanding.
The trails around Ambiegna offer stunning natural beauty. You might encounter dramatic red granite cliffs like the Calanches de Piana (approx. 22 km away) or the scenic Gorges de Spelunca (approx. 19 km away). The area also features forested surroundings and coastal views, with highlights such as the Rocher des Gozzi and the Liamone Sandy Terraces and Wetland Zone.
Yes, many of the mountain bike routes around Ambiegna are designed as loops. For example, the Capigliolo Tower – Sagone loop from Tiuccia is a moderate 51.7 km route, and the Beautiful view – Tiuccia loop from Lombarda offers a 27.4 km moderate ride.
